    SN74AHC245DWR Description

    SN74AHC245DWR Description

    The SN74AHC245DWR is a high-performance, 8-bit, non-inverting bus transceiver designed by Texas Instruments. It is part of the 74AHC series and is currently active in the market. This device is compliant with the REACH regulation and RoHS3 directive, ensuring environmental safety and sustainability. The SN74AHC245DWR operates within a wide supply voltage range of 2V to 5.5V, making it suitable for various applications. It is surface-mounted and comes in a tape and reel packaging, ideal for automated assembly processes.

    SN74AHC245DWR Features

    • Technical Specifications:

      • Number of Bits per Element: 8
      • Voltage - Supply: 2V to 5.5V
      • Current - Output High, Low: 8mA each
      • Moisture Sensitivity Level (MSL): 1 (Unlimited)
      • Mounting Type: Surface Mount
      • Package: Tape & Reel (TR)
